The 2022 Rippon Sauvignon Blanc boasts a distinctive complexity with notes of tatami mat, torched lemongrass, and beeswax, complemented by a savory, textural mouthfeel and a fresh, green leaf finish. It has earned high praise from critics, including 94 points from Erin Larkin of The Wine Advocate.

A portion of this wine was fermented in old French barrels, which enhances its texture through extended lees contact and natural stirring, without imparting oak flavors. This innovative method contributes to its rich, cloth-like texture and depth.

This Sauvignon Blanc is noted for its steely, mineral core and a balance that allows for a few years of evolution in the bottle. It offers bright acidity and unique flavors like gooseberry and wild strawberry, making it a standout choice for aging.

      The Rippon Sauvignon Blanc 2022 showcases the unique character of its terroir with a rich and complex profile. Fermented partially in old French barrels, the wine gains a distinctive texture and depth through extended lees contact, enhancing its mouthfeel without overshadowing its fresh, vibrant fruit. Aromas of tatami mat, torched lemongrass, and beeswax introduce a savory and textural quality, while a hint of juniper and lemon sherbet adds intriguing layers.

      On the palate, the wine reveals a raspy, acid-driven profile with flavors of gooseberry, wild strawberry, and a touch of manuka honey. Its bright acidity and mineral core are balanced by a softly evolving finish, making it a versatile wine with the potential for further development. This Sauvignon Blanc is both refreshing and complex, ideal for those who appreciate a distinctive and age-worthy expression of the variety.
